Multichip LED Module

May 11, 2006
The OTLA-0100 multichip LED module has nine LEDs housed in a compact, thermally conductive ceramic substrate.

The high-density device is targeted for use in fluorescenceexcitation equipment, colorimeters, blood analyzers, clinical chemistry analyzers, and DNA analyzers. Wavelengths range from ultraviolet through the visible red spectrum (383, 405, 470, 505, 530, 570, 594, 660, and 700 nm) and can be individually controlled. The module's small source size makes it ideal for coupling secondary focusing optics.
